Speedo Problem - Inconsistent

Ok, long story which I'll try to shorten up, whilst leaving in all the necessary details:

The old speedo was reading slow by 4 MPH, not by a percentage. Regardless of whether you're doing 30 or 60 MPH, it's off by 4 MPH. I was told the reason for this is the speedo was not properly "zero'd" when it was manufactured. The odometer was dead on accurate.

It was about 3x as much as buying a new one to get mine rebuilt. So I bought a new one from LMC. Now here is what's happening: The speedo will randomly read accurately (within 1 MPH per my GPS). BUT! At its own will, it will read slow at 40 MPH by as much as 5 MPH, and in the same run, will read fast by about the same at 70 MPH.

In English, if the speedo reads 40 MPH, I'm doing 45. If it reads about 76 MPH, I'm doing about 70 MPH... But not all the time! I called LMC and to their credit, they had no problem sending me a new one, which I installed. The same exact results are happening with this one.

Now, you are probably thinking what I am thinking: replace the cable. I'm going to do that, but why wouldn't this have been an issue with the old speedo???

Am I just getting crap units from LMC? Or do you think it's as simple as a cable problem, even though it wasn't an issue with the original speedo?
